  • the invention relates to a method and an auxiliary device for opening pressed fiber bales with the features in the preamble of the main method and device claim.
  • Such auxiliary devices are known as complete automatic bale openers from DE-A-41 19 158 and DE-A-41 26 372. In both cases there is a stationary or movable mandrel that presses around the mandrel
  • the fiber bale grips under wrapped strapping and lifts it off the bale.
  • a suitable separation device e.g. works with a cutting wheel, then cuts the strapping. If the fiber bales also have packaging, this can also be removed using a puller.
  • the known bale opener has the disadvantage that the mandrel can sometimes be very difficult to reach under the strapping, especially if the strapping digs deep into the surface of a fiber bale compressed under very high pressure. In this case there is also a risk of damage to the fibers. In addition, malfunctions due to strapping not being cut in the downstream fiber and bale processing machines cannot be ruled out.
  • the invention solves this problem with the features in the main method and device claim.
  • the auxiliary device according to the invention for opening ⁇ on Pressed fiber bales can be designed as a fully or semi-automatic bale opener and alternatively in a particularly simple embodiment as a manual bale opener.
  • the fiber bale is strapped on two opposite and by the press
  • the auxiliary device according to the invention or the complete bale opener are particularly reliable and can be used for any fiber pressed bale. They are particularly suitable for fiber bales that have been compacted under a very high pressure of several hundred tons in a previous baler.
  • the press of the auxiliary device has a suitable design for this.
  • the auxiliary device according to the invention or the complete bale opener can be automated better than previously known devices.

  • fiber bales (2) are processed, which consist of short cut or long natural or plastic fibers, which are used as staple fibers. or Tow.
  • the fiber bales (2) have been compressed and compressed under high pressure in an upstream baler (not shown).
  • the pressing force can be 500 t or more.
  • These fiber bales (2) have been provided with several straps (3) in the baler, which hold the compacted bales together after they have been relieved.
  • the strapping (3) can consist of metal or plastic bands.
  • the fiber bale (2) can also have packaging under or over the strapping (3).
  • This packaging (not shown) can consist, for example, of two or three film blanks, one or more bags or the like.
  • the strapping (3) and the packaging can in principle be of any design his .
  • An auxiliary device (1) for opening the fiber bale (2) is provided for this. It is arranged in the fiber treatment plant behind a bale store (13) or a bale feed and is on the other hand in front of a so-called bale display (14), on which the opened fiber bale (2) is milled off or removed in another suitable way to obtain a loose fiber stream.
  • a suitable transport device (15), e.g. an indoor crane transports the opened fiber bale (2) from the auxiliary device (1) to the bale display (14).
  • Any other processing machines for the fibers can be connected to the bale display (14). These are preferably machines and systems which nonwoven products, e.g. Nonwovens.
  • the auxiliary device (1) has a press (4) which compresses the fiber bale (2) on at least two bale sides (16) in such a way that the strapping (3) at least partially on at least one other exposed bale side (17) becomes loose and Stand laterally away from the fiber bale (2) in this loose area (12). In this position, the loose areas (12) of the strapping (3) can be undercut and cut or otherwise cut by a suitable separating device (5).
  • the separating device (5) is shown only schematically in FIG. 3 as scissors.
  • the press (4) has two opposing press rams (7) which compress and compress the fiber bale (2) between them in the pressing direction (11).
  • the press (4) is used to generate the required high pressure forces. accordingly suitable formed and for example, has a stable frame (9) and a strong Press' oning (10), which for example is designed as a hydraulic cylinder.
  • the press punches (7) engage on two opposite bale sides (16), on which strapping (3) is located. As a result, the pressing force is directed at least in regions along the circumferential strapping (3).

Abstract

L'invention concerne un procédé et un dispositif auxiliaires (1) pour ouvrir des bottes de fibres (2) comprimées qui sont pourvues d'au moins un cerclage (3) et, éventuellement, d'un emballage. La botte de fibres (2) est, à l'aide d'une presse (4), soumise à une pression au niveau d'au moins deux côtés de botte (16) opposés et recouverts des cerclages (3), et ainsi comprimée. Cette réduction de la botte soulage les cerclages (3) qui dépassent ainsi, de façon lâche, sur au moins un autre côté de botte (17) libre. Dans cette zone lâche (12), les cerclages (3) sont ensuite coupés et retirés de la botte de fibres (2) manuellement ou mécaniquement.
